Control that took control.
Restriction, bingeing, purging, compulsive rules about what and when, the patterns differ, but the engine is usually the same: an attempt to regulate feelings and worth through the one variable that seemed controllable. High-performing lives hide it exceptionally well.
Disordered eating frequently travels with anxiety, trauma, and substance use.
